Transaction 745659f09401bdf663e949afa3ceb4db8ba63536c2dde91410bc01a3bfaf3973
1 Input
1 Output
-
745659f09401bdf663e949afa3ceb4db8ba63536c2dde91410bc01a3bfaf3973:0
- value
- 2172806
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3944921e28ee5ee9d592322fc5d958afc29c7c52 OP_EQUAL
- address
- 36uparmbRdXWYFRT9Xx8DtSsFZ6n16677J